Output 57c80f24212dc804184f6263487757543c91f07e354ae9a48b56dca746359a9e:1

value
21707000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c9e71716d53d7250f4b47a6751cba2921cf423 OP_EQUAL
address
MLeJ2YGPYjuT6XzLjGgza3tawL4ARb4K95
transaction
57c80f24212dc804184f6263487757543c91f07e354ae9a48b56dca746359a9e
spent
true